CLEVELAND, Ohio - Cleveland State capped a perfect Saturday at the CSU Dome Tournament with a 6-3 win over Canisius on Saturday night. 

The Vikings defeated Robert Morris earlier in the day and is now 2-2 this year.

The Vikings jumped on the board early with two runs in the first inning on a Macy Kaisk two-run homer. Canisius answered with a run in the bottom half of the inning, but the Vikings responded with a run in the third on a double steal of second and home to push the lead to 3-1.

A Kaitlin Gairing RBI single in the fourth scored Bailee Gray to make it 4-1, but the Golden Griffins came back with two runs in the fourth to slice the deficit to 4-3.

It remained that way until the seventh when Hannah Breeden drilled an RBI double into the gap and Gray added another insurance run with an RBI groundout.

Mackenzie Joecken worked four innings, giving up three runs, to earn the win, while Breeden worked the seventh inning to earn the save. Taylor Miokovic pitched two iinnings and didn't give up a hit.

CSU closes play in the tournament on Sunday with a 4:00 pm game against Canisius.
